Ticket: UploadGate misclassifies UTF-16 text files as binary when the BOM is absent, skipping sanitization. Security reviewer: please assess whether this bypasses the script-injection filter. Fix adds heuristic detection with a strict fallback to rejection on ambiguity. No user data retained in test fixtures. Repro attached against the build listed below.

trace token, fafog-kageg: htk4_98e6

## Key Ceremony Checklist — Item 7: Pagination Signing Key

Almost done! This item covers the key that signs pagination cursors for the Wrenfield public REST API. Opaque cursors beat page numbers, but they only work if the signing key survives ceremonies like this one. Confirm both custodians are present, verify the sealed envelope is intact, and initialize the HSM slot. When the slot prompts you, enter the recovery passphrase that follows.

unlock words, hahip-baduf: holwyn-istath-julvan

## Configuration

The Inkwright markdown pipeline sanitizes all rendered HTML before caching; raw HTML passthrough is disabled by default and gated behind a signed flag. Rendered output is stored in the Thornvale cache tier with per-tenant keys. The renderer authenticates to that cache with a write credential, set on the line immediately following.

sealed setting: ARCHIVE_KEY3=8d0

## Signing the quota artifacts

Per-tenant rate quotas for Hatchreed ship as a single signed bundle, so support can be sure nobody hand-edited a tenant's limits on a box somewhere. If a customer swears their quota changed overnight, check the bundle signature first — an invalid one means the file was touched outside the release flow. Re-publishing a corrected bundle is fine, but it has to be signed with the key directly below.

deploy key for kafof-kaguf: bky9_WnPyu8S2E